Hi Guys and Gals, I have just finished writing a book about my 40 odd years, on and off in the airline industry both in NZ and also AUS. One of the airlines that I worked for was Mount Cook Airlines. I remember travelling to Mount Cook on a leased Air Pacific HS-748 DQ-FBH which stayed in Air Pacific colours but operated in NZ as ZK-MCJ. I took a photo of the aircraft sitting on the ramp at Mt Cook against a background of snow and I wanted to include the photo in my book but I can't find it. I know it's a long shot but perhaps someone may have taken a similar photo at some other stage or may know of somebody who has one. I am still trawling through Google but no success as yet. Any help would be gratefully accepted. Many thanks
